Title: [6597] trunk/arch/blackfin: fix bug [#5207] - define SPI data irq in resource.

Diff

Modified: trunk/arch/blackfin/mach-bf527/boards/cm_bf527.c (6596 => 6597)


--- trunk/arch/blackfin/mach-bf527/boards/cm_bf527.c	2009-06-05 12:11:11 UTC (rev 6596)
+++ trunk/arch/blackfin/mach-bf527/boards/cm_bf527.c	2009-06-05 12:33:37 UTC (rev 6597)
@@ -664,6 +664,11 @@
 	[1] = {
 		.start = CH_SPI,
 		.end   = CH_SPI,
+		.flags = IORESOURCE_DMA,
+	},
+	[2] = {
+		.start = IRQ_SPI,
+		.end   = IRQ_SPI,
 		.flags = IORESOURCE_IRQ,
 	},
 };

Modified: trunk/arch/blackfin/mach-bf533/boards/H8606.c (6596 => 6597)


--- trunk/arch/blackfin/mach-bf533/boards/H8606.c	2009-06-05 12:11:11 UTC (rev 6596)
+++ trunk/arch/blackfin/mach-bf533/boards/H8606.c	2009-06-05 12:33:37 UTC (rev 6597)
@@ -266,6 +266,11 @@
 	[1] = {
 		.start = CH_SPI,
 		.end   = CH_SPI,
+		.flags = IORESOURCE_DMA,
+	},
+	[2] = {
+		.start = IRQ_SPI,
+		.end   = IRQ_SPI,
 		.flags = IORESOURCE_IRQ,
 	}
 };

Modified: trunk/arch/blackfin/mach-bf533/boards/blackstamp.c (6596 => 6597)


--- trunk/arch/blackfin/mach-bf533/boards/blackstamp.c	2009-06-05 12:11:11 UTC (rev 6596)
+++ trunk/arch/blackfin/mach-bf533/boards/blackstamp.c	2009-06-05 12:33:37 UTC (rev 6597)
@@ -162,6 +162,11 @@
 	[1] = {
 		.start = CH_SPI,
 		.end   = CH_SPI,
+		.flags = IORESOURCE_DMA,
+	},
+	[2] = {
+		.start = IRQ_SPI,
+		.end   = IRQ_SPI,
 		.flags = IORESOURCE_IRQ,
 	}
 };

Modified: trunk/arch/blackfin/mach-bf533/boards/cm_bf533.c (6596 => 6597)


--- trunk/arch/blackfin/mach-bf533/boards/cm_bf533.c	2009-06-05 12:11:11 UTC (rev 6596)
+++ trunk/arch/blackfin/mach-bf533/boards/cm_bf533.c	2009-06-05 12:33:37 UTC (rev 6597)
@@ -160,6 +160,11 @@
 	[1] = {
 		.start = CH_SPI,
 		.end   = CH_SPI,
+		.flags = IORESOURCE_DMA,
+	},
+	[2] = {
+		.start = IRQ_SPI,
+		.end   = IRQ_SPI,
 		.flags = IORESOURCE_IRQ,
 	}
 };

Modified: trunk/arch/blackfin/mach-bf533/boards/ezkit.c (6596 => 6597)


--- trunk/arch/blackfin/mach-bf533/boards/ezkit.c	2009-06-05 12:11:11 UTC (rev 6596)
+++ trunk/arch/blackfin/mach-bf533/boards/ezkit.c	2009-06-05 12:33:37 UTC (rev 6597)
@@ -196,6 +196,11 @@
 	[1] = {
 		.start = CH_SPI,
 		.end   = CH_SPI,
+		.flags = IORESOURCE_DMA,
+	},
+	[2] = {
+		.start = IRQ_SPI,
+		.end   = IRQ_SPI,
 		.flags = IORESOURCE_IRQ,
 	}
 };

Modified: trunk/arch/blackfin/mach-bf537/boards/cm_bf537.c (6596 => 6597)


--- trunk/arch/blackfin/mach-bf537/boards/cm_bf537.c	2009-06-05 12:11:11 UTC (rev 6596)
+++ trunk/arch/blackfin/mach-bf537/boards/cm_bf537.c	2009-06-05 12:33:37 UTC (rev 6597)
@@ -182,8 +182,13 @@
 	[1] = {
 		.start = CH_SPI,
 		.end   = CH_SPI,
+		.flags = IORESOURCE_DMA,
+	},
+	[2] = {
+		.start = IRQ_SPI,
+		.end   = IRQ_SPI,
 		.flags = IORESOURCE_IRQ,
-	}
+	},
 };
 
 /* SPI controller data */

Modified: trunk/arch/blackfin/mach-bf537/boards/minotaur.c (6596 => 6597)


--- trunk/arch/blackfin/mach-bf537/boards/minotaur.c	2009-06-05 12:11:11 UTC (rev 6596)
+++ trunk/arch/blackfin/mach-bf537/boards/minotaur.c	2009-06-05 12:33:37 UTC (rev 6597)
@@ -184,6 +184,11 @@
 	[1] = {
 		.start = CH_SPI,
 		.end   = CH_SPI,
+		.flags = IORESOURCE_DMA,
+	},
+	[2] = {
+		.start = IRQ_SPI,
+		.end   = IRQ_SPI,
 		.flags = IORESOURCE_IRQ,
 	},
 };

Modified: trunk/arch/blackfin/mach-bf537/boards/pnav10.c (6596 => 6597)


--- trunk/arch/blackfin/mach-bf537/boards/pnav10.c	2009-06-05 12:11:11 UTC (rev 6596)
+++ trunk/arch/blackfin/mach-bf537/boards/pnav10.c	2009-06-05 12:33:37 UTC (rev 6597)
@@ -398,8 +398,13 @@
 	[1] = {
 		.start = CH_SPI,
 		.end   = CH_SPI,
+		.flags = IORESOURCE_DMA,
+	},
+	[2] = {
+		.start = IRQ_SPI,
+		.end   = IRQ_SPI,
 		.flags = IORESOURCE_IRQ,
-	}
+	},
 };
 
 /* SPI controller data */

Modified: trunk/arch/blackfin/mach-bf537/boards/tcm_bf537.c (6596 => 6597)


--- trunk/arch/blackfin/mach-bf537/boards/tcm_bf537.c	2009-06-05 12:11:11 UTC (rev 6596)
+++ trunk/arch/blackfin/mach-bf537/boards/tcm_bf537.c	2009-06-05 12:33:37 UTC (rev 6597)
@@ -182,6 +182,11 @@
 	[1] = {
 		.start = CH_SPI,
 		.end   = CH_SPI,
+		.flags = IORESOURCE_DMA,
+	},
+	[2] = {
+		.start = IRQ_SPI,
+		.end   = IRQ_SPI,
 		.flags = IORESOURCE_IRQ,
 	}
 };

Modified: trunk/arch/blackfin/mach-bf548/boards/cm_bf548.c (6596 => 6597)


--- trunk/arch/blackfin/mach-bf548/boards/cm_bf548.c	2009-06-05 12:11:11 UTC (rev 6596)
+++ trunk/arch/blackfin/mach-bf548/boards/cm_bf548.c	2009-06-05 12:33:37 UTC (rev 6597)
@@ -612,6 +612,11 @@
 	[1] = {
 		.start = CH_SPI0,
 		.end   = CH_SPI0,
+		.flags = IORESOURCE_DMA,
+	},
+	[2] = {
+		.start = IRQ_SPI0,
+		.end   = IRQ_SPI0,
 		.flags = IORESOURCE_IRQ,
 	}
 };
@@ -626,6 +631,11 @@
 	[1] = {
 		.start = CH_SPI1,
 		.end   = CH_SPI1,
+		.flags = IORESOURCE_DMA,
+	},
+	[2] = {
+		.start = IRQ_SPI1,
+		.end   = IRQ_SPI1,
 		.flags = IORESOURCE_IRQ,
 	}
 };

Modified: trunk/arch/blackfin/mach-bf561/boards/cm_bf561.c (6596 => 6597)


--- trunk/arch/blackfin/mach-bf561/boards/cm_bf561.c	2009-06-05 12:11:11 UTC (rev 6596)
+++ trunk/arch/blackfin/mach-bf561/boards/cm_bf561.c	2009-06-05 12:33:37 UTC (rev 6597)
@@ -177,8 +177,13 @@
 	[1] = {
 		.start = CH_SPI,
 		.end   = CH_SPI,
+		.flags = IORESOURCE_DMA,
+	},
+	[2] = {
+		.start = IRQ_SPI,
+		.end   = IRQ_SPI,
 		.flags = IORESOURCE_IRQ,
-	}
+	},
 };
 
 /* SPI controller data */
_______________________________________________
Linux-kernel-commits mailing list
[email protected]
https://blackfin.uclinux.org/mailman/listinfo/linux-kernel-commits

Reply via email to